Introduction

Mark your calendars for an important day of empowerment, support, and recognition this December 4th, which is Choose Women Wednesday! Introduced by Women's Entrepreneurship Day Organization, this holiday is all about honoring and supporting women in business worldwide. This day is a fantastic opportunity to promote gender equality in the commercial sphere and create awareness about female entrepreneurship. So gear up to celebrate the innovative and inspiring women in our lives who are breaking barriers and leading the way. It's a day filled with admiration, gratitude, and, most importantly, choices that make a real difference!
